Early Saver must be chosen at time of booking. It gives you a price guarantee if the price drops before you make your final payment, you get your price adjusted. If the price drops after you make your final payment, you are given onboard credit. I only book with Early Saver

FTTF does not show up as an option until 6 months out from your cruise. Whoever you spoke with at Carnival had no clue and was grasping at straws I think.
Even if you did not use it to get on early.....there are plenty of other uses for it and I have used them all at one time or another..... I have had it on all of my cruises so far.
If you called Carnival back, you would get yet another different answer....lol
Not true.....I booked my cruise for August back in October and I purchased FTTF the day I booked the cruise

Just got off phone with Carnival rep. She confirmed the new rate for a 7 day cruise is $37.50 per day plus 15% gratuity. She said you must purchase the first day and you can no longer purchase the second day. Asked her about tax if purchased in port before getting into international waters. She could not answer
